On Monday, the Darien City Council voted unanimously for regulations, limiting hens to six, mandating privacy fences and requiring permits. WHEATON, IL (February 10, 2021) After a long effort by local advocates and nonprofit Sustain DuPage, residents in unincorporated DuPage County now have the right to own hens. It is important to clean the coop frequently as a build up of droppings will cause a build up in ammonia, which can be damaging to the respiratory systems and eyes of your hens.
